Bago is magical for the photographer but so is Yangon, etc. Yangon's famous Swedagon Pagoda is amazing! About an hours drive is Bago. I would visit Bago's Schwemawdaw Pagoda & the Shwethalyaung Reclining Buddha. Stay at the Pansea Hotel in Yangon. Have a drink in the bar of the Strand.

Read the trip report I just filed. My suggestion is beyond any doubt to go to Bagan for two days and spend one day in Yangon. If you have a fourth day to effectively visit, go to Bago, where the most beautiful reclining buddha is. Bago is a full two hours drive though. Bagan can be reached by plane quite easily. I have found Yangon Airways very reliable.
